Jim Elledge, award-winning author of The Boys of Fairy Town; Henry Darger, Throwaway Boy; and over twenty other titles, has won two Lambda Literary Awards. The Boys of Fairy Town was also a finalist for a Lammy, received a starred review in Booklist, and was included in ALA’s Over the Rainbow Book List.
